&#060;p&#062;You can of course do tonal and high contrast (light pink and dark red for instance). But I think that tonal contrast looks softer than, say, white and dark red, which is more graphic.  I think you are drawn to a more vibrant and graphic contrast. But of course you can like and wear both!&#060;/p&#062;

&#060;p&#062;To answer your question - I like CONTRAST, even when I wear monochromatic and tonal looks - my belt, shoes and eyewear stand out. &#038;nbsp;Like with all red, all shocking pink, all lime green - I wear contrasting cream shoes and bag (or gold)! With white jeans I like gold shoes. With cream jeans I like taupe, gold, blush, and light blue shoes. With blush pants, I like red shoes. The outfit formula is alive and kicking!&#038;nbsp;&#060;/p&#062;
